Output 74590577ee4d7d4936d5ef1af00c9adc948b912558bb6890791516b505144f97:0

value
17627987
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9120609caab1e65af6ea878f37fd0f69dcdef7e7 OP_EQUALVERIFY OP_CHECKSIG
address
1EEMmSHWzRUF5eBZJLYzB7Vz3wniTTTgyt
transaction
74590577ee4d7d4936d5ef1af00c9adc948b912558bb6890791516b505144f97
spent
true